Littelfuse (NASDAQ: LFUS) is a diversified industrial technology manufacturing company shaping solutions for the safe and efficient transfer of electrical energy. Headquartered in Chicago, Illinois, USA, we serve customers across industrial, transportation, and electronics markets worldwide. With approximately 16,000 employees we design and manufacture innovative technologies that support electrification, energy efficiency, and advanced automation. As a Sr. Financial Systems & BI Analyst, you will be responsible for supporting and enhancing Littelfuse’s financial systems and business intelligence capabilities within the Corporate FP&A team. Your role will focus on OneStream administration and optimization, financial reporting, dashboard development, and driving automation and AI-enabled analytics solutions to improve business decision-making.

About the Job:

  • Serve as a key FP&A administrator for the OneStream platform, including metadata, security, and application maintenance.

  • Support forecasting cycles by managing templates, monitoring submissions, validating data inputs, and troubleshooting issues for global finance users.

  • Drive enhancements and optimization initiatives within OneStream to improve forecasting, reporting, dashboards, workflows, and automation capabilities.

  • Collaborate with FP&A and business stakeholders to translate reporting and analytics requirements into scalable system solutions.

  • Develop and maintain dashboards and reporting solutions using Power BI and other BI tools.

  • Redesign and streamline financial reporting processes to improve speed, accuracy, usability, and automation.

  • Identify opportunities to leverage AI-enabled tools and automation to enhance financial insights and reporting efficiency.

  • Support monthly financial reporting activities, including variance analysis against forecast, budget, and prior year results.

  • Partner cross-functionally with finance and business teams to provide actionable insights and improve decision-making processes.

  • Collaborate with external implementation partners on system expansions, upgrades, and continuous improvements.
